After a student changes majors, if the courses he studied in the original major are the same or similar to the corresponding compulsory courses required by the teaching plan for changing majors in terms of teaching content, academic performance, etc., it can be regarded as obtaining corresponding credits; Other course credits can be used as elective credits.
After the students' grades change, if the training plan and professional education and teaching plan change, the identification and conversion of the courses they studied in the original grade shall be implemented with reference to the above rules.
If a student terminates his studies and re-takes the college entrance examination, the identification and conversion of his original courses in our school shall be implemented with reference to the above rules.
If students stop taking minor courses in the middle, they can apply to convert their minor course credits into elective course credits for major courses before the third week of graduation semester.
